Hint: Red cannon needs to take blacks 9th file pawn to win.
  1. C9=1
Red takes thing slow and easy with this move. Black is forced to take the elephant as he cannot check now.
  1.      R9-1
  2. P5=4 A5+6
  3. R8=4 K6-1
  4. C1=4 A6-5
  5. H6+4
Although a relatively simple endgame, but nevertheless, without the taking of the pawn in the first move and the 2 consecutive sacrifices in the next few moves, red would not have been able.